Step-by-Step Instructions for Zucchini Chips in the Air Fryer
- Begin by washing and drying two medium zucchinis. Cut them into uniform ¼” to ½” rounds, ensuring each slice is even for consistent cooking.
- Set up your dredging station by placing three bowls in a row: mix flour, salt, and pepper; beat eggs in the second; and combine breadcrumbs and Parmesan in the third.
- Dip one zucchini slice into the flour mixture, then into the beaten eggs, and finally coat it with the panko-Parmesan mixture before arranging them on a plate.
- Preheat your air fryer to 375°F and spray the basket with cooking spray. Arrange the coated zucchini slices in a single layer.
- Lightly spray the tops of zucchini chips with cooking spray, air fry for about 6 minutes, flip, spray again and cook an additional 5 minutes or until golden brown.
- Once done, transfer chips to a serving platter, allow to cool briefly, and serve immediately with your favorite dip.
